Subject: Handover of rate-limiting ownership in Gatewright

As discussed, ownership of the rate-limiting configuration in the Gatewright internal gateway is changing ahead of the 4.2 release. Please route all threshold adjustments, burst-policy exceptions, and quota rollback requests through the new owner rather than the platform rotation. Effective Monday, all sign-offs on limiter changes go to the person named below.

account owner for bawip-tahag: Raleth Quenok

Onboarding note — Tessery render pipeline. Template rendering is our hottest path; the Fernlake cache layer keeps p95 under 40ms by precompiling partials at deploy time. Any change to the compiler invalidates the cache and must ship through the signed release channel, never a hotfix. As part of your review, confirm each compiled bundle's signature matches the release artifact. The deploy key used for those signatures appears below.

release key, hadug-kawef: bky13_mPGeFZeR1GZ1G

**Q: How does Tandemerge handle record deduplication, and what data is retained?**

Tandemerge compares candidate customer records using hashed name, postal, and phone fields; raw values never leave the primary datastore. Merged records keep an audit trail of both source IDs for ninety days, after which the losing record is purged. All merge decisions are logged and reviewable. The complete data-retention and access-control policy for the dedupe pipeline is documented here.

runbook for tajep-yahig: https://artifactory.lumictech.corp/repo

### Audit Item 14: Customer Record Deduplication

Verify the Marlowe dedup job ran against the full customer table before cutover. Confirm merge conflicts were resolved, not skipped. Check the survivorship rules matched the Brindlewood policy doc. Spot-check twenty merged records. Release cannot proceed without a signed attestation. Direct all questions on this item to the responsible owner.

named custodian: Brivan Eliath Quenox Frador

Checkout load test — Quillbasket platform. Plugin authors: run your hooks against the staging gateway only. Ramp profile is fixed at 200→800 VUs over 8 minutes; do not modify. Your plugin must keep added latency under 50ms p95 or it will be excluded from the composite run. Results post to the Harrowgate dashboard within an hour. Verify your harness targets the correct build, identified by the token below.

pipeline stamp: htk3_cc5